Another 6.3-Magnitude Earthquake Rattles Afghanistan

HeadlineOct 11, 2023

Afghanistan was rocked by another 6.3-magnitude earthquake early this morning in western Herat province, as locals are still reeling from Saturday’s series of deadly quakes. The region’s governor said today’s earthquake caused “huge losses,” though it’s not clear yet how many people were killed or displaced. Rescuers are still working to recover residents who perished over the weekend. This is one of the survivors.

Ahmad: “In some neighboring villages, dead bodies are still under the rubble. They couldn’t pull the bodies yet. Some people have tents, and some do not. I have no tent. We cannot spend the winter here.”
